2 # based on http://doeidoei.wordpress.com/2010/11/23/compressing-files-with-python-symlink-trouble/
3 import os
, sys
, zipfile
, string
7 usage: find . -name \*.jpg -or -name \*.png -print0 | python cbzl.py curimgs.cbz
8 or: locate -0 .jpg | python cbzl.py allimgs.cbz
12 with zipfile
.ZipFile (sys
.argv
[1], "w") as z
:
13 zerosep
= sys
.stdin
.read ()
14 files
= string
.split (zerosep
, '\0')
16 a
= zipfile
.ZipInfo ()
17 a
.filename
= os
.path
.basename (name
)
19 a
.external_attr
= 2716663808L